Abstract

The utility model provides a roasting device for nut processing, and belongs to the technical field of nut processing devices. This baking equipment, comprising a base plate, the upper end welding of bottom plate has the landing leg, the upper end of landing leg has a section of thick bamboo of drying by the fire through the bolt fastening, the left end of a section of thick bamboo of drying by the fire articulates through the hinge has the apron, the skin weld of apron has the handle, it is equipped with conveying mechanism and heating mechanism on the section of thick bamboo to dry by the fire, conveying mechanism includes the backup pad, the backup pad is fixed in the side surface of a section of thick bamboo of drying by the fire, the upper end of backup pad is fixed with the motor, the output of motor is fixed with the rotation axis, the one end that the motor was kept away from to the rotation axis is installed the bearing, the outer lane welding of bearing has the dead lever, the dead lever welds in the inner wall of a section of thick bamboo of drying by the fire. The utility model can continuously bake the nuts, effectively improves the working efficiency, simultaneously effectively improves the nut baking uniformity and improves the nut baking quality.

Technical Field
The utility model relates to the field of nut processing devices, in particular to a roasting device for nut processing.
Background
Nuts, a classification of closed fruit, have a hard pericarp and contain 1 or more seeds. Such as chestnut, almond, etc. The nuts are the essential parts of plants, are generally rich in nutrition, contain high protein, grease, mineral substances and vitamins, and have excellent effects on growth and development of human bodies, physique enhancement and disease prevention. According to the research of an authority, the following results are obtained: eating more than twice a week can reduce the risk of a person suffering from fatal heart disease, an accurate result of a U.S. physician health research program investigating twenty thousand men.
At present, nut baking equipment on the market is of a great variety, but can't accomplish continuous production when toasting the nut, causes production efficiency low, simultaneously, leads to toasting unevenly easily when toasting the nut, is unfavorable for guaranteeing product quality.
Disclosure of Invention
In order to make up for the defects, the utility model provides a roasting device for nut processing, which aims to solve the problems that nut drying devices in the market are various in types, but continuous production cannot be realized during nut drying treatment, so that the production efficiency is low, and meanwhile, uneven drying is easily caused during nut drying, so that the product quality is not favorably ensured.
The utility model is realized by the following steps:
the utility model provides a roasting device for nut processing, which comprises a bottom plate, wherein supporting legs are welded at the upper end of the bottom plate, a roasting cylinder is fixed at the upper end of each supporting leg through bolts, the roasting cylinder is horizontally arranged, the right end of the roasting cylinder is open, the left end of the roasting cylinder is hinged with a cover plate through a hinge, the cover plate can shield the right end of the roasting cylinder to a certain degree to avoid excessive heat leakage, a handle is welded on the surface of the cover plate to facilitate pulling of the cover plate, a conveying mechanism and a heating mechanism are arranged on the roasting cylinder, the conveying mechanism is used for conveying nuts during roasting and ensuring the roasting uniformity, the heating mechanism is used for providing heat energy for drying, the conveying mechanism comprises a supporting plate, the supporting plate is fixed on the side surface of the roasting cylinder, a motor is fixed at the upper end of the supporting plate, the motor is a speed regulating motor and can automatically regulate the rotating speed according to use requirements, the output of motor is fixed with the rotation axis, the bearing is installed to the one end that the motor was kept away from to the rotation axis, the outer lane welding of bearing has the dead lever, the dead lever welds in the inner wall of a section of thick bamboo of baking, is favorable to ensureing rotation axis pivoted stability.
In an embodiment of the utility model, a support frame is fixed on the surface of the baking cylinder, a fan is fixed on the surface of the support frame through a bolt, a first pipeline is fixed at the output end of the fan, and the first pipeline is communicated with the inside of the left-end barrel body of the baking cylinder through a pore passage.
In an embodiment of the utility model, a second pipeline is fixedly installed at the input end of the fan, the second pipeline is communicated with the inside of the barrel body at the right end of the baking barrel through a pore passage, and hot air at the right end of the baking barrel is favorably input into the left end of the baking barrel through the fan so as to increase the circulation of internal heat and improve the baking quality.
In an embodiment of the utility model, a filter screen is arranged at an inlet of the inner wall of the second pipeline at one end far away from the fan, so that nuts are prevented from being sucked into the fan, and the normal use of the roasting device is ensured.
In an embodiment of the present invention, the heating mechanism includes a first groove, the first groove is opened on an inner wall of the roasting cylinder, a heating pipe is disposed in the first groove, the heating pipe is an air heating pipe, and the heating pipe facilitates heat transfer to a surface of the nuts in the roasting cylinder through the partition plate, so as to roast the nuts.
In an embodiment of the utility model, a partition plate is fixed on the inner wall of the first groove, one side surface of the partition plate is tightly attached to the inner wall of the roasting cylinder, the radian of the partition plate is the same as that of the inner wall of the roasting cylinder, smooth conveying and roasting of nuts in the roasting cylinder are facilitated, and the partition plate is made of high-temperature-resistant glass material, so that the durability is ensured.
In an embodiment of the utility model, a plurality of groups of first grooves are arranged at equal intervals along the circumferential direction of the inner wall of the baking cylinder, so that the baking efficiency and the baking uniformity are improved, and the product quality is improved.
In one embodiment of the utility model, the surface of the rotating shaft is fixed with a helical blade, the helical blade is beneficial to continuously conveying roasted nuts to the outlet while roasting, and the distance between the helical blade and the inner wall of the roasting cylinder is not more than one centimeter, so that the nuts are prevented from being blocked.
In one embodiment of the utility model, a feed hopper is arranged at the upper end of the baking cylinder, and a valve is arranged on the feed hopper, so that the baking amount of nuts can be controlled, and the practicability is improved.
The utility model has the beneficial effects that: according to the roasting device for nut processing, which is obtained through the design, the motor drives the spiral blade to rotate, and the spiral blade further drives the nuts to rotate in the roasting cylinder to be roasted and slowly move to the outlet, so that the nuts can be continuously roasted and processed, and the working efficiency is effectively improved.
Through the heating pipe, heat a section of thick bamboo inside toasting, make the heat flow in a section of thick bamboo of toasting through the fan, cooperate the motor to drive helical blade to rotate simultaneously, make the nut toast and slowly move to the exit at a section of thick bamboo internal rotation of toasting, effectively improve the degree of consistency that the nut toasted, improved the nut and toasted the quality.

Referring to fig. 1-4, the heating mechanism 300 includes a first groove 301, the first groove 301 is opened on the inner wall of the roasting cylinder 102, a heating pipe 302 is disposed in the first groove 301, the heating pipe 302 is an air heating pipe, and it is beneficial for the heating pipe 302 to transfer heat to the surface of the nuts in the roasting cylinder 102 through a partition 303, so as to roast.
The inner wall of first recess 301 is fixed with baffle 303, a side surface of baffle 303 hugs closely the setting and the radian is the same with the inner wall of a section of thick bamboo 102 of toasting, be favorable to the nut in the inside smooth transport of a section of thick bamboo 102 of toasting and toast, baffle 303 is high temperature resistant glass material, the durability has been ensured, first recess 301 is provided with the multiunit along the inner wall circumference equidistance of a section of thick bamboo 102 of toasting, thereby be favorable to improving the efficiency of toasting and the degree of consistency of toasting, product quality has been improved.
Specifically, this roasting device for nut processing's theory of operation: during the use, pour the nut into feeder hopper 105, then starter motor 202 and heating pipe 302, thereby preheat the stoving section of thick bamboo 102 inside, then open valve 106 thereby make the nut stable fall into the stoving section of thick bamboo 102 in, adjust motor 202 rotational speed, then thereby drive helical blade 206 and rotate, helical blade 206 further drives the nut and toasts and slowly removes to the exit in the stoving section of thick bamboo 102 internal rotation, start fan 208 at the stoving in-process simultaneously, and then will toast the heat of a section of thick bamboo 102 right-hand member through fan 208 and pass through second pipeline 210 suction fan 208, and the left end of a section of thick bamboo 102 is toasted in reentrant through first pipeline 209, thereby make the heat in the stoving section of thick bamboo 102 flow, with the degree of consistency that improves the nut and toasts, the nut toasts quality has been improved.
